What Is the Cisco DS-C9148V-24IK9?

The ​​Cisco DS-C9148V-24IK9​​ is a high-performance ​​48-port multilayer Fibre Channel switch​​ designed for enterprise storage area networks (SANs). As part of Cisco’s MDS 9000 Series, it supports ​​32 Gbps port speeds​​ and offers ​​24 pre-activated ports​​, with scalability to enable additional ports via licensing. Built for reliability, it features a ​​1U rack-mountable form factor​​ and advanced telemetry for real-time network analytics.


Key Features and Technical Specifications

  1. ​Port Configuration and Speed​

    • ​48 multispeed ports​​: Autosensing capabilities for 2/4/8/16/32 Gbps Fibre Channel, with 24 ports active by default.
    • ​Non-blocking architecture​​: Ensures ​​low latency​​ and consistent performance under high traffic.
  2. ​Scalability and Licensing​

    • ​Incremental port activation​​: Licenses allow enabling additional ports in blocks of 8.
    • ​Compatibility​​: Supports ​​FC-NVMe​​ workloads without hardware upgrades.
  3. ​Management and Security​

    • ​Cisco Prime DCNM integration​​: Centralized management for multi-switch environments.
    • ​Redundant components​​: Dual power supplies and cooling systems for ​​99.999% uptime​​.
